# Python如何读取图片的数据类型
## 问题描述
我们在处理图像数据时,常常需要了解图像的数据类型及其相关信息。例如,我们可能想知道一张图片的格式、大小、通道数等信息,以便进行后续的处理。
## 解决方案
Python提供了多种库和方法来读取和处理图像数据。下面将介绍使用Pillow库来读取图片的数据类型,并给出示例代码。
### 安装Pillow库
Pillow是一个强大的Pytho
原创
2023-08-24 19:41:09
424阅读
1. imghdr是什么 imghdr是一个用来检测图片类型的模块,传递给它的可以是一个文件对象,也可以是一个字节流。 能够支持的图片格式:2. 如何使用提供了一个api叫做imghdr.what,这个方法接受两个参数,第一个参数是一个文件对象,第二个参数是一个字节流数组。 文件对象用来对本地文件做检测,字节流用来对网络上的做检测。当需要对文件进行检测的时候只传入第一个参数即可。当需要对一个字节流
转载
2023-10-07 19:52:18
109阅读
实验环境: google colab1、使用PIL Pillow 官网文档import os
os.chdir("/content/drive/My Drive/tmp/");
from PIL import Image
im=Image.open('1.png') # 读取图片 对于彩色图像,不管其图像格式是PNG,还是BMP,或者JPG,在PIL中,使用Image模块的open()函数打开后
转载
2023-07-01 15:31:39
218阅读
经常看到有人在网上询问关于imread()函数读取图片失败的问题。今天心血来潮,经过实验,总结出imread()调用的四种正确姿势。通常我要获取一张图片的绝对路径是这样做的:在图片上右键——属性——安全——对象名称。然后复制对象名称就得到了图片的绝对路径。如图:然而这样得到的路径直接复制粘贴到vs里面会直接报错,如下:可以看出我们获取的绝对路径的表示方法是单右斜线形式的。显然opencv的imre
转载
2023-08-28 09:33:22
57阅读
# Python如何查看数据库数据类型
在进行数据库操作时,了解每个字段的数据类型非常重要。Python提供了各种库来连接和操作数据库,例如`sqlite3`,`pymysql`和`psycopg2`等。这些库允许我们连接到数据库,并执行查询和操作。
## 解决问题的背景
假设我们正在使用Python连接到一个关系型数据库,并需要查看数据库中表的数据类型。这是一个常见的问题,特别是在数据分析
原创
2023-08-10 18:41:04
60阅读
Python是一种简单易学的编程语言,它具有广泛的应用领域,其中之一就是处理图像。在Python中,图像数据类型是一个重要的概念,它决定了我们如何处理图像以及可以进行的操作。本文将详细介绍Python中常用的图像数据类型,并提供相应的代码示例。
## 图像数据类型概述
在Python中,常见的图像数据类型有以下几种:
1. 数组(Array):图像可以表示为一个二维或三维的数组,每个元素对应图像
原创
2023-10-10 15:24:32
400阅读
一、python xlrd读取datetime类型数据:(1)使用xlrd读取出来的时间字段是类似41410.5083333的浮点数,在使用时需要转换成对应的datetime类型,下面代码是转换的方法:首先需要引入xldate_as_tuple函数 from xlrd import xldate_as_tuple 使用方法如下: #d是从excel中读取出来的浮点数
xlda
转载
2023-06-15 01:25:07
138阅读
我正在尝试从CSV文件中搜索数据,然后将数据传递给另一个python代码。CSV文件具有100000+行,我希望根据自己的选择传递所请求的数据。实际代码:input_file = 'trusted.csv'
users = []
with open(input_file, encoding='UTF-8') as f:
rows = csv.reader(f,delimiter=",",linet
转载
2023-06-26 17:51:05
308阅读
前言:python处理数据文件的途径有很多种,可以操作的文件类型主要包括文本文件(csv、txt、json等)、excel文件、数据库文件、api等其他数据文件。下面小编整理下python到底有哪些方式可以读写数据文件。1. read、readline、readlinesread() :一次性读取整个文件内容。推荐使用read(size)方法,size越大运行时间越长readline() :每次读
转载
2023-06-02 15:46:11
456阅读
# Python读取MySQL数据类型
MySQL是一个流行的开源关系型数据库管理系统,许多Python开发人员使用它来存储和管理数据。Python提供了许多用于与MySQL数据库进行交互的库,其中最常用的是`mysql-connector-python`和`PyMySQL`。
在本文中,我们将探讨Python如何读取MySQL中的不同数据类型。MySQL支持各种数据类型,包括整数、浮点数、字
原创
2024-01-13 09:14:21
103阅读
一、直接输入数据。直接使用键盘输入数据需要注意的是输入数据的类型,一般是使用列表(list)类型,如下图所示:直接定义一个数据导入的函数,并将函数返回值设为dataSet和label变量,在主程序的其它部分或者其他函数中则可以通过调用loadDataSet()函数实现数据的载入。需要注意的是,利用该种方法得到的输入数据实际上是list类型的数据,如果想要对数据进行相关运算,则需要利用python中
转载
2023-09-04 10:36:20
79阅读
事务的基本要素原子性:事务是一个原子操作单元,其对数据的修改,要么全都执行,要么全都不执行一致性:事务开始前和结束后,数据库的完整性约束没有被破坏。隔离性:同一时间,只允许一个事务请求同一数据,不同的事务之间彼此没有任何干扰。持久性:事务完成后,事务对数据库的所有更新将被保存到数据库,不能回滚。Mysql的存储引擎InnoDB存储引擎:InnoDB存储引擎支持事务,其设计目标主要面向在
转载
2023-08-25 16:08:56
66阅读
Python基础 对于Python,一切事物都是对象,对象基于类创建 不同类型的类可以创造出字符串,数字,列表这样的对象,比如"koka"、24、['北京', '上海', '深圳']数据类型1、如何查找数据类型支持的方法python终端:name=”koka“
type(name)
<cl
转载
2023-06-19 10:16:26
231阅读
数据的获取与处理写在前面:本文从北京公交路线数据的获取和预处理入手,记录使用python中requests库获取数据,pandas库预处理数据的过程。文章在保证按照一定处理逻辑的前提下,以自问自答的方式,对其中每一个环节进行详细阐述。本次代码均在jupyter notebook中测试通过,希望对大家有所启示。数据获取: 本次我们从公交网获取北京公交的数据。(http://beijing.gongj
转载
2023-08-22 16:46:24
58阅读
点赞
python基本数据类型详解一、整型int存储年龄,身份证号等age = 18
id = 0000001
# 注:可以使用type关键字查看变量的数据类型
print(type(age)) # <class 'int'>
print(type(id)) # <class 'int'>二、浮点型float存储薪资,身高,体重等salary = 10000.14
height
转载
2023-06-25 11:19:19
113阅读
本文主要向大家介绍了Python语言读取mnist,通过具体的内容向大家展示,希望对大家学习Python语言有所帮助。在做 TensorFlow和Python实现神经网络的时候,需要利用到一个MNIST数据集,数据集的格式是以.idx1-ubyte后缀,包含60000个训练图像。将这些图像展示出来,需要利用到[struct模块] iii.run。下载MNIST训练数据集手动下载
转载
2023-06-30 21:14:43
57阅读
基本数据类型 Python中的基本数据类型分为:数字,字符串,布尔值,列表,元组,字典关于这些基本数据类型对象常见掉用法介绍 数字: int (int型所有功能都在 int 里面,在Pychram中建立文件输入int,按住Crtl鼠标点击int 进入查看) #将字符串转换为数字
a = "123"
b = int(a)
#会报错转换中的字符串只能有数字
a = "123"
转载
2024-06-25 16:05:05
44阅读
1.MySQL中的BLOB类型Mysql中可以存储大文件数据,一般使用的BLOB对象。如图片,视频等等。BLOB是一个二进制大对象,可以容纳可变数量的数据。因为是二进制对象,所以与编码方式无关。有4种BLOB类型:TINYBLOB、BLOB、MEDIUMBLOB和LONGBLOB。它们只是可容纳值的最大长度不同。四种字段类型保存的最大长度如下:复制代码 代码如下:TINYBLOB - 255 by
转载
2023-06-01 09:45:11
562阅读
# Python读取表格后的数据类型
---
## 流程图
```mermaid
flowchart TD
A[读取表格] --> B[获取表格数据] --> C[数据类型转换] --> D[打印数据类型]
```
---
## 介绍
在Python中,我们可以使用`pandas`库来读取表格数据。读取后,我们可能需要对表格中的数据类型进行转换,以便后续的数据处理和分析。本文将
原创
2023-09-18 11:39:15
131阅读
# 怎样在Python中控制读入的图片数据类型
作为一名经验丰富的开发者,我将向你展示如何在Python中控制读入的图片数据类型。这对于刚入行的小白来说可能是一个挑战,但是只要按照下面的步骤来操作,你就能轻松地实现这个目标。
## 整体流程
首先,让我们看一下整个操作的流程。我将使用表格展示每个步骤:
```mermaid
flowchart TD
A[开始] --> B{读取图片
原创
2024-03-07 05:50:39
17阅读